Understanding Helmet Safety Standards: The Foundation of Head Protection

When you're pushing your vehicle to its limits on track, your helmet becomes your most critical safety companion. But not all helmets are created equal—the certification standards behind them tell a very different story.

Racing helmet safety standards comparison reveals two dominant certification bodies: Snell Memorial Foundation and Fédération Internationale de l'Automobile (FIA). Each employs distinct testing methodologies and impact thresholds that directly influence your cranial protection during high-velocity incidents.

The complexity of modern helmet certification extends beyond simple impact resistance. Today's standards evaluate energy absorption, penetration resistance, flame retardancy, and retention system integrity through rigorous laboratory protocols that simulate real-world crash scenarios.

Snell Standards: The American Approach to Impact Protection

Snell Memorial Foundation has established itself as the preeminent helmet certification authority in North America. Their SA (Special Application) standards specifically target motorsports applications with enhanced fire resistance and impact protection.

The current SA2020 standard implements a dual-impact testing protocol—something that sets it apart from many competitors. This methodology subjects helmets to two consecutive impacts at the same location, simulating scenarios where drivers experience multiple collisions during a single incident.

Key Snell Testing Parameters

  • Impact velocity: 7.75 meters per second against steel anvils
  • Maximum allowable deceleration: 300G peak
  • Flame exposure: 45-second burn test at 790°C
  • Chin strap strength: 300-pound minimum breaking force

The rigorous nature of Snell testing often results in heavier helmet construction. Manufacturers must incorporate additional energy-absorbing materials to meet the stringent dual-impact requirements, which can affect overall weight distribution and driver fatigue during extended track sessions.

FIA Certification: European Engineering Excellence

The FIA approach to helmet certification emphasizes single-impact energy management and weight optimization. Their 8860-2018 standard represents the current pinnacle of international motorsports head protection requirements.

FIA testing protocols prioritize realistic impact scenarios found in professional motorsports. The certification process evaluates helmets against multiple impact velocities and angles, creating a comprehensive assessment of protective capabilities under varied crash dynamics.

The single-impact philosophy allows manufacturers to optimize energy absorption materials differently than Snell requirements. This often results in lighter helmets with advanced composite shells that excel in professional racing environments.

Performance Comparison: Which Standard Suits Your Driving Style?

The choice between Snell and FIA certification ultimately depends on your specific motorsports activities and sanctioning body requirements. Many professional series mandate FIA certification, while grassroots organizations often accept either standard.

Aspect Snell SA2020 FIA 8860-2018
Impact Philosophy Dual-impact resistance Single-impact optimization
Typical Weight Heavier construction Lighter materials
Fire Protection 45-second exposure Advanced flame-resistant materials

Track day enthusiasts often gravitate toward Snell certification due to its widespread acceptance and robust dual-impact protection. Professional racers frequently choose FIA-certified helmets for their optimized weight characteristics and series compliance requirements.
